Carson Palmer on Bengals tilt: 'Not just another game'

Carson Palmer won't lapse into cliches and jock-talk in advance of Sunday night's clash with the Cincinnati organization that shipped him to the Oakland Raiders after a 2011 staredown with Bengals owner Mike Brown.

"It's not just another game," Palmer said Wednesday, via Paul Dehner of the Cincinnati Enquirer. "I'm not going to bore you with that. There is definitely a lot on this one for me in particular."

Palmer acknowledged to NFL Media columnist Michael Silver in September that he still holds ill feelings about the situation in which the disenfranchised quarterback walked away from football to force his way out of Cincinnati.
